package pgtype_test
import (
"math/big"
"testing"
"github.com/jackc/pgtype"
"github.com/jackc/pgtype/testutil"
)
func TestNumericMultirangeTranscode(t *testing.T) {
testutil.TestSuccessfulTranscode(t, "nummultirange", []interface{}{
&pgtype.Nummultirange{
Ranges: nil,
Status: pgtype.Present,
},
&pgtype.Nummultirange{
Ranges: []pgtype.Numrange{
{
Lower: pgtype.Numeric{Int: big.NewInt(-543), Exp: 3, Status: pgtype.Present},
Upper: pgtype.Numeric{Int: big.NewInt(342), Exp: 1, Status: pgtype.Present},
LowerType: pgtype.Inclusive,
UpperType: pgtype.Exclusive,
Status: pgtype.Present,
},
},
Status: pgtype.Present,
},
&pgtype.Nummultirange{
Ranges: []pgtype.Numrange{
{
Lower: pgtype.Numeric{Int: big.NewInt(-42), Exp: 1, Status: pgtype.Present},
Upper: pgtype.Numeric{Int: big.NewInt(-5), Exp: 0, Status: pgtype.Present},
LowerType: pgtype.Inclusive,
UpperType: pgtype.Exclusive,
Status: pgtype.Present,
},
{
Lower: pgtype.Numeric{Int: big.NewInt(5), Exp: 1, Status: pgtype.Present},
Upper: pgtype.Numeric{Int: big.NewInt(42), Exp: 1, Status: pgtype.Present},
LowerType: pgtype.Inclusive,
UpperType: pgtype.Inclusive,
Status: pgtype.Present,
},
{
Lower: pgtype.Numeric{Int: big.NewInt(42), Exp: 2, Status: pgtype.Present},
LowerType: pgtype.Exclusive,
UpperType: pgtype.Unbounded,
Status: pgtype.Present,
},
},
Status: pgtype.Present,
},
})
}
